  • Sonoma, CA sits in a valley surrounded by rolling hills, and that geography shapes how water damage plays out. Homes near Sonoma Creek face seasonal flooding risks, while hillside properties deal with runoff that channels toward foundations. Older neighborhoods closer to the historic plaza often have aging plumbing, making pipe failures a common call alongside storm-related intrusion.

  • A restoration pro responding to a burst pipe or flooding event in Sonoma, CA typically starts with water extraction using truck-mounted equipment, then sets industrial air movers and dehumidifiers to dry structural materials. From there, the scope often expands to mold inspection, subfloor assessment, and drywall removal in saturated areas. Homes near lower-lying parts of the Sonoma Valley may also need crawl space drying.

  • Sonoma Creek runs through the valley floor and can rise quickly during heavy winter rains, putting homes in lower-elevation neighborhoods at real risk. Emergency water removal in Sonoma along creek-adjacent streets often involves standing water in garages and ground-floor rooms. Clay-heavy soils in the area also slow drainage, keeping moisture against foundations longer than homeowners expect.

  • Cleaning gutters before the rainy season, checking crawl space venting, scheduling an annual plumbing inspection on older pipes, and clearing debris from downspout extensions are four low-cost steps that reduce risk for most Sonoma, CA homeowners.

  • Sump pump installation, crawl space encapsulation, backwater valve fitting on older sewer lines, whole-house leak detection systems, and repiping galvanized supply lines are the upgrades that consistently protect Sonoma, CA homes and appeal to buyers during inspections.

  • Sonoma, CA receives most of its annual rainfall between November and March, and that concentrated wet season puts real pressure on drainage systems, crawl spaces, and older rooflines. Homeowners who inspect gutters, sump pumps, and foundation vents before November typically see fewer emergency calls when the rains arrive in earnest.
